Man... you are late AF to the game lol. It is way too late to network at this point, basically every BB didn't do any FT recruiting or hired a handful of analysts through referrals, EBs have finished their process, and MMs are either finishing up with 1st round interviews or already have done some superdays.

That being said, perhaps you go to a school with on-campus recruiting, so maybe there are a few spots left via that.

 

Yeah I realized that and have been calling a lot of people this past week. I have spoken to a few banks that are still looking for a couple analysts and am trying super hard to go further. I don't go to a target school...

What would you say I should do if I don't end up getting a FT gig? Should I try to get a summer analyst position? Go for corp finance?
